Output d59b1161f94121a28e74705d05c5f225de19104f765ab7f6a2100bfd10d6fb75:0

value
14372806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8927dc3e49425ff60b9175dd6ee679eba0aa28c1 OP_EQUAL
address
3ECEFNKqMjXCq26cii1xcdxKpBtJm6ozHq
transaction
d59b1161f94121a28e74705d05c5f225de19104f765ab7f6a2100bfd10d6fb75
confirmations
266252
spent
true